The left atrial appendage (LAA) plays a significant role in the context of atrial fibrillation due to its anatomical and hemodynamic characteristics. In patients with atrial fibrillation, the chaotic electrical activity can lead to stasis of blood flow in the LAA. This stagnation is primarily due to the LAA's unique shape and its relatively low blood movement, making it an ideal environment for thrombus (blood clot) formation.

When atrial fibrillation occurs, the lack of coordinated atrial contraction means that blood can pool in the LAA. This pooling increases the risk of clot development, which can subsequently embolize and lead to strokes or other systemic embolic events. Consequently, occlusion of the LAA is a preventive measure aimed at reducing the risk of these fatal complications in patients with non-valvular atrial fibrillation.
